Grigory Shabrov: In Memoriam, by Oleg Stepurko (translated by Diana Kondrashina)
Trumpeter, composer and ex-member of Vitaly Kleynot's band, the first jazz rock band in Russia, Oleg Stepurko remembers his bandmate, pianist Grigory Shabrov, who passed away after prolonged illness on December 2, 2010.
